The teaching and training unit (L’Unité de Formation et d’Enseignement - UFE) of the Observatoire de Paris organizes theoretical and practical courses for teachers and science demonstrators.
Many kinds of courses are available :


Training in astronomy and observation of the sky
The course takes place at the Observatoire de Haute Provence. The activities depends of the level of the participants. The subjects treated span the major astronomical themes included in school programmes, and small telescopes, as well as an 80cm telescope, are used for the observations.


Training in radioastronomy
This course, which is both theoretical and practical, is in the first instance destined for high school teachers (collèges and lycées) wishing to learn radioastronomy. Are covered the history and basic ideas of radioastronomy, the principles underlying the instruments at Nançay and their scientific results, as well as the major international projects.


Training in the observation of the sky
During the period October to February, one Wednesday per month with the Moon in roughly in first quarter phase, observational sessions are organized for teachers. The 38cm refractor in the Arago dome of the Paris site is used.


Academic training plan and local internships
The Observatoire de Paris is pursuing actively a policy involving local education authorities to encourage the initial and continued training of teachers.
